Friend, are you struggling to be more feminine and soft-spoken in your marriage? Do you end up angry and controlling when you really want to be kinder and more self-controlled as a godly wife?
You are not alone, and that is why in this episode (PART 1), I am sharing 6 MORE ways you can show up today with Biblical femininity and womanhood. Biblical femininity is NOT about your personality or how you look, it is so much more than that! I go deep into what Biblical femininity and biblical womanhood are in this episode using Proverbs 31 as our framework.
